A new route to the sintering of MgB2 has been identified, based on a reactive infiltration of liquid Mg on a powdered B preform. The technique allows to obtain large bulk manufacts in an inexpensive way, without the need of high pressure apparatus. The best of the obtained samples shows a transport current density of 3 kA/cm(2) at 4.2K and 9 T. The critical aspects of the technology are presented, together with the recent achievements and the perspective applications.
